Is it unusual for F1? I'm sure a few Minardi and Arrows sponsors failed to stump up back in the day. And Super Aguri had some supposed oil trading company as a sponsor that never coughed up cash. And then all the recent-ish nonsense surrounding Team Lotus/ Enstone.

God knows what kind of sponsors were there before, but we didn't have google to check them out.

There are a whole bunch of myWorld and Sports World companies registered with Companies House, but none of them has filed accounts.  There are a couple of Austrians and a Slovenian (who crops up in the Paradise Papers linked to Lyconet) involved.  Mix of sports marketing and cashback, because obviously those two things are a thing.
